/* CSS Document */

span.cfred                    {color:#ff0000;}
#motorhome_stock                        {background-color:#FFFFFF; }
h2.cf                                                {float:left; font-size:1.0em; font-weight:900; line-height:1.1em; padding:0px;  margin:0px;  color:#3E3E3E;}

.motorhome                                        {color:#000; list-style:none; height:6.6em; border:0.06em solid #fff; padding:0em; margin:0em; padding-top:10px; background-color:#DBEAE4; font-family:Arial, Helvetica, sans-serif;}
.motorhome2                                        {color:#000; list-style:none; height:6.6em; border:0.06em solid #fff; padding:0em; margin:0em; padding-top:10px; background-color:#fff;  font-family:Arial, Helvetica, sans-serif;}


.motorhome_icons                        {width:4.5em; height:6.88em; float:left;}

.motorhome_thumbnail                {float:left;   width:6.9em; padding-right:0em; margin-left:0em;}
.thumbnail                               {width:6.25em; float:left; border:0.06em solid #5D1721; line-height:5em; text-align:center;  background-color:#FFFFFF }


span.more_info                                {line-height:1.5em; font-size:0.9em;}




.motorhome_details                         {width:31em; float:left; margin-left:2em; height:6.5em; }
.motorhome_title                        {width:100%; height:20px; clear:both; }

.motorhome_price                        {width:6.5em;  float:right; line-height:2.0em; margin-left:1em; text-align:left; }
.motorhome_spec                                {width:19em; float:left; padding:0px; margin:0px; color:#3E3E3E;}




ul.motorhome_spec_1                        {float:left;  width:8em; margin:0px; padding:0px; padding-left:0.9em; }
ul.motorhome_spec_2                        {float:right; width:8em; margin:0px; padding:0px; padding-left:0.9em; }

li.motorhome_spec_3                        {list-style:square; padding:0em; margin:0em; line-height:1.3em;   font-size:0.8em; font-weight:100; color:#3E3E3E; }



span.price                                        {font-size:1.2em; font-family:Arial, Helvetica, sans-serif;  color:#3E3E3E;}

a.more_d:link                                {color:#585858; font-size:0.9em; margin-left:20px;}
a.more_d:visited                        {color:#585858; font-size:0.9em; margin-left:20px;}
a.more_d:hover                                {color:#ff0000; font-size:0.9em;}


/**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**/
#stock_pages                                {height:24px; background-color:1F4F70; padding:5px; margin-bottom:10px; margin-right:1px; margin-top:10px; clear:right; line-height:1.4em; }

#page_previous                                {float:left; height:18px; line-height:1.0em; }
#pages                                                {float:left; height:18px; line-height:1.0em; }
#page_next                                        {float:left; height:18px; line-height:1.0em; }

a.pages:link                                {font-size:0.9em; font-weight:bold;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;}
a.pages:visited                                {font-size:0.9em; font-weight:bold;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if;}
a.pages:hover                                {color:#FF0000;}

span.TPages                                        {float:left; width:170px; font-size:0.9em; color:#fff; font-family:Arial, Helvetica, sans-serif;}
span.pagesOn                                {font-size:0.9em; color:#FF0000; font-weight:bold; font-family:Arial, Helvetica, sans-serif;}
/**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**** PAGES **/


/** SAVING PRICE **/
.motorhome_price_saving                {width:6.5em;  float:right; line-height:2.0em; margin-left:1em; text-align:left;  }
h4.cf                                                {padding:0px; margin:0px; line-height:1.0em; text-align:left; font-size:0.9em; padding-bottom:5px;}
.dealPrices                                        {font-size:0.75em; float:left;  }
.dealSaving                                        {font-size:0.75em; float:left; padding-top:2px;}

span.black                                        {color:#000000; }
span.blue                                        {color:#3F6884;}
span.red                                        {color:#FE0000;}
.crossThrough                                {text-decoration:line-through;}
/** SAVING PRICE **/